Pressure cookers are an essential cooking appliance in many households. They offer a convenient way to prepare meals quickly while retaining flavors and preserving nutrients. However, like any other kitchen appliance, pressure cookers can encounter issues and require repairs. In this article, we will explore common pressure cooker problems and provide some tips for repair.
1. Pressure Release Valve Malfunction: The pressure release valve is a crucial component that regulates the pressure inside the cooker. If it gets clogged or stops functioning correctly, it can cause problems. You may experience difficulties in building pressure, or the cooker may release steam continuously. Cleaning or replacing the valve can often solve this issue.
2. Sealing Ring Wear and Tear: The sealing ring is responsible for creating a tight seal between the lid and the pot. Over time, it may wear out or become damaged, resulting in steam leaks and reduced pressure buildup. Inspecting and replacing the sealing ring periodically is essential to maintain proper functionality.
3. Lid Jamming: Sometimes, the pressure cooker lid may get stuck or become difficult to open or close. This can be due to improper alignment or debris accumulation. Carefully cleaning the lid and ensuring proper alignment of the parts can often resolve this problem.
1. Read the Instruction Manual: Before attempting any repairs, always refer to the instruction manual provided with your pressure cooker. It will contain valuable information on troubleshooting common problems specific to your model.
2. Clean and Maintain Regularly: Regularly cleaning and maintaining your pressure cooker can extend its lifespan and prevent potential issues. Clean the vent pipe, the pressure release valve, and the sealing ring after every use to remove food residues and prevent clogging.
3. Identify the Problem: Diagnose the issue by observing the cooker's behavior. Is it not building pressure, not releasing pressure, or leaking steam? Identifying the problem will help you focus on the relevant components during repair.
4. Order Genuine Parts: If you need to replace any components, always opt for genuine parts from the manufacturer. This ensures compatibility and helps maintain the pressure cooker's safety features and performance as intended.
5. Seek Professional Help: If you are unsure or uncomfortable with repairing the pressure cooker yourself, it is best to seek professional assistance. Professional repair services are well-equipped with the knowledge and tools required to resolve intricate issues.
Repairing a pressure cooker can save you money by avoiding the need for a new appliance. By understanding common problems and following basic maintenance practices, you can prolong the life of your pressure cooker. Remember to handle repairs cautiously and reach out to professionals when needed. With proper care and timely repairs, your pressure cooker will continue to serve you delicious meals for years to come.
